With so many indie games out each month, there are so many indie games you might have missed. In this video, Get Indie Gaming look back at some of the best new indie games of March 2020, consider them in some cases new indie game hidden gems, you might have missed first time around across PC, PS4, Switch and Xbox.

Featured games with timestamps:
0:21 - 7: Creature in the Well: https://blog.us.playstation.com/2020/03/16/creature-in-the-well-bounces-onto-ps4-march-31/
2:00 - 6: Freedom Finger: https://www.playstation.com/en-us/games/freedom-finger-ps4/
3:01 - 5: Alder’s Blood: https://www.nintendo.com/games/detail/alders-blood-switch/
4:39 - 4: Wunderling: https://www.nintendo.com/games/detail/wunderling-switch/
6:10 - 3: Afterparty: https://www.nintendo.com/games/detail/afterparty-switch/
7:21 - 2: One Step from Eden: https://store.steampowered.com/app/960690/One_Step_From_Eden/
8:42 - 1: Good Job! https://www.nintendo.com/games/detail/good-job-switch/
